Resumé

After a short introduction to the author’s experience of the creation of “Middelaldercirklen”, the article focuses on Anselm of Canterbury’s view on the first crusade. Previous research has generally stated that Anselm opposed the crusade idea as it was not compatible with his theological and religious thinking. Based on Sally N. Vaughn’s studies of Anselm’s political career, the article reevaluates Anselm’s view on the first crusade and argues that Anselm didn’t oppose but rather supported the first crusade. At the same time the article also points to the differences in the view on crusading between Anselm and the reform papacy.
